I have been struggling quite a bit to work out how to control trim planes and how and when they will work and on what.
In this example, I've been trying to write a script for an Utzon courtyard house (see pic). Basically, it's an L-shaped building on two sides of a courtyard with a shed roof raising outward from the courtyard. Now, the way I constructed the roof (see script), it requires a split to miter the two roof parts in order to avoid overlapping geometry where they meet. But I can't make it work.
Could someone please give an overview of how to use trim? Because I obviously either don't know, or I try to make it do stuff which it can't do. In the latter case, is there an alternative way for me to reach my goal?
